1 Child Protection Panel Annual Report 2008 / 09 Allison Watt, Trust Directors Pres

2 Panel: Key Developments 2008/09 -Establishment of Single Trust Child Protection Panel -Inspection / Inquiries / Reviews / Audit -R I T -Professional Guidance on Attachment -Review of Child Protection Register Re-Registrations

10 Progress on Objectives 2008/09 1Inspection / Inquiries / CMR’s / Reviews / Audit -Update Action Plans e.g Laming -Sharing the Learning Seminars 2Childcare / Mental Health Interface -Interim Childcare / Mental Health Protocol -Cross Programme Information Session 3Child Care / Public Protection Unit Interface -Awareness raising session with PPU / Gateway Teams 4Transition to Safeguarding Structures -Panel Workshop -Regional Input

11 Panel Objectives 2009/10 -Transition to Regional Safeguarding Structures -Electronic Regional Child Protection Register -Inspections / CMR’s / Inquiries / Reviews -PSNI UNOCINI Pilot Re: Domestic Violence / Juvenile Incidents -Public Protection Arrangements / Child Protection Interface
